From 39fa19316add06ddbe5d21c212cd925386ac5c2c Mon Sep 17 00:00:00 2001
From: pfdietz <pfdietz@localhost>
Date: Wed, 27 Apr 2005 12:25:26 +0000
Subject: [PATCH] More sequence tests, on fill, sort, subseq, count, length,
 reverse, nreverse.  There may be a problem with the destructive tests in that
 it's not allowed to modify literal objects in code, and the objects may
 appear in EQL type specifiers.

+
+(defmacro rfill (x y &rest other-args)
+  `(fill ,y ,x ,@other-args))
+
+(def-type-prop-test fill.1 'rfill
+  (list t #'make-random-sequence-type-containing)
+  2 :replicate '(nil t))
+
+(def-type-prop-test fill.2 'rfill
+  (list 'integer #'make-random-sequence-type-containing)
+  2 :replicate '(nil t))
+
+(def-type-prop-test fill.3 'rfill
+  (list 'character #'make-random-sequence-type-containing)
+  2 :replicate '(nil t))
+
+(def-type-prop-test fill.4 'rfill
+  (list t #'make-random-sequence-type-containing
+	'(eql :start)
+	#'(lambda (v s k1) (declare (ignore v k1))
+	    (let ((len (length s)))
+	      `(integer 0 ,len))))
+  4 :replicate '(nil t nil nil))
+
+(def-type-prop-test fill.5 'rfill
+  (list t #'make-random-sequence-type-containing
+	'(eql :end)
+	#'(lambda (v s k1) (declare (ignore v k1))
+	    (let ((len (length s)))
+	      `(integer 0 ,len))))
+  4 :replicate '(nil t nil nil))
+
+(def-type-prop-test fill.6 'rfill
+  (list t #'make-random-sequence-type-containing
+	'(eql :start)
+	#'(lambda (v s k1) (declare (ignore v k1))
+	    (let ((len (length s)))
+	      `(integer 0 ,len)))
+	'(eql :end)
+	#'(lambda (v s k1 start k2)
+	    (declare (ignore v k1 k2))
+	    (let ((len (length s)))
+	      `(integer ,start ,len))))
+  6 :replicate '(nil t nil nil nil nil))
